I thought it would be polite to post how its turning out.
I had a rezoom put in my left eye last thursday (8th). Vision was pretty
blurry in that eye for a couple of days and as I was wary of going
anywhere near my eyes for a day I tried wearing my spectacles with my
left lens removed. It was absolutely impossible. I just couldnt resolve
the two images, could do very little and had headaches and nausea.
When I got brave I put a contact lens in my right eye. Its so much
easier. Not fantastic, but better.
Now my rezoom eye has improved to the point where in the evening I can
take out my right contact lens and still see good enough to watch the tv
fairly comfortably. The distance vision on the rezoom is very very
sharp. Intermediate and near are improving to the point where I can
almost read the computer monitor with my left eye. I can just about read
the small print on my medication insert. I do have some halos but they
arent bad. Some ghosting on bright images on the tv but they are
starting to improve I think.
Next week I'm having the Tecnis multifocal in my right eye.
